Egypt, Kuwait Negotiate to Increase Crude Oil Imports

Egypt is negotiating a contract renewal with Kuwait to import its crude oil to Egypt with double the quantity and adjustments to the merit rating scale, according to an official source, Al Rai reported.

Egypt imports around 2 million barrels of crude oil from Kuwait, in addition to 1.2 million tons of other petroleum products per month.

The official source stated that upon the contract’s expiry, Egypt required to raise the imports to 4 million barrels per month.

Meanwhile, the source pointed out that Egypt requires to extend the installment period which follows the exported shipment to around 16 months instead of nine.
